Ebonyi State Governor, Francis Nwifuru, has directed his Special Assistant on Water Resources, Franklin Ukah, and his counterpart in Housing and Urban Development, Patrick Enyi, to take charge of their respective ministries as acting commissioners. The development followed the recent sack of some commissioners, and suspension of others, by the governor. Nwifuru also directed his Special Assistant on Primary Health, Dr Sabinus Nwibo, to take charge of the State Ministry of Health as acting commissioner. A former member of the Bauchi State House of Assembly, Adamu Bello, has officially rejoined the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) after leaving the All Progressives Congress (APC). Bello, a founding member of the APC in Bauchi State and a key figure in the Bauchi North Senatorial District, served as the Sole Administrator of Giade Local Government Area. The Bauchi State chapter of the Peoples Democratic Party(PDP), has suspended Habibu Umar, the lawmaker representing Kirfi Constituency in the State House of Assembly. The lawmaker has been barred from all party activities until further notice. In a letter addressed to the Speaker of the Bauchi State House of Assembly, the PDP State Chairman, Samaila Burga, stated that Umar was found guilty of insubordination by the party in line with its Constitution. Justice Maryann Anenih of the High Court of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T) has fixed 10 December, 2024 for ruling in the bail applications by former Kogi State governor, Yahaya Bello and two others. The Judge fixed the date after taking arguments for and against the bail request by Bello’s lawyer, Joseph Bodunde Dauda, SAN, and Kemi Pinheiro, SAN, for the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, EFCC. The Kaduna State Internal Revenue Service (KADIRS) has sealed off a premise of Unity Bank, Chicken Republic and the Bank of Agriculture (BOA) and First City Monument Bank (FCMB) all located along Yakubu Gowon Way over N100 billion tax liabilities. The agency also sealed off the Hamdala Hotel. Leading an enforcement team, Board Secretary and Executive Director Legal Services, Barrister Aisha Ahmad, said the agency embarked on the enforcement of non-payment of the Land Use Tax after exhausting all legal avenues of settlement.
